At the Pet Shop
A pair work activity for elementary pupils. Part A (B is in a separate file). A chance to revise numbers 1 to 10 and learn animal names. There are two different pictures.Pupils write the number of animals in their own Pet Shop. Then with a partner (A & B) they make a dialogue asking each other what they have got in their pet shop.

Remembrance Day
To commemorate REMEMBRANCE DAY on 11TH NOVEMBER my students watched a short video about �The Poppy Story�. https://www.youtube.com/watch?v=K8Jv0T9eFUY They discussed it in groups. We then mada a classroom display board with some poppy cards where they answered the question "Why should we never forget?" We read the famous poem on Flanders Fields...

Friends survey
Hi! This is a walk around survey about friends. Pupils go around the classroom and ask and answer questions with 4 different classmates. Lesson plan included to give some ideas what to do before and after this activity.

Get an attitude
Activities for the start of a new school year to think about a positive attitude in class. Includes choosing a smiley to represent student�s attitude, questionnaire about class attitude, pairwork comparing and reporting,making new resolutions and rules for class behaviour.
